TIFF

TIFF (Tagged Image File Format) is a versatile graphic file format renowned for its ability to store high-quality images. Commonly used in photography, publishing, and scanning, TIFF supports multiple layers and channels, making it ideal for professional use. Its lossless compression ensures pristine image quality, providing a reliable choice for archiving, printing, and versatile editing applications.

HDR

HDR (High Dynamic Range) is an advanced image format that captures a wider range of luminosity, enabling stunning visuals with detailed highlights and shadows. Ideal for digital photography, gaming, and cinematic content, HDR enhances the overall viewing experience by delivering rich color depth and realism. It's widely supported across various platforms and devices, making it essential for photographers and videographers aiming for exceptional quality.

Use Cases for TIFF to HDR

Here are day to day use cases of TIFF to HDR

Convert scanned artwork TIFF to HDR for digital archiving

Artists and archivists convert high-resolution TIFF scans of paintings, illustrations, or historical documents to HDR format to preserve a wider dynamic range and color gamut, ensuring digital archives capture subtle tonal variations and details that standard formats might lose.

Prepare medical imaging TIFFs for HDR diagnostic displays

Medical professionals convert TIFF images from MRI, CT scans, or X-rays to HDR to utilize specialized high-dynamic-range diagnostic monitors. This enhances the visibility of subtle contrasts in tissue density, improving diagnostic accuracy and detail review.

Transform architectural visualization TIFFs into HDR for realistic lighting

Architects and 3D artists convert rendered TIFF images of building designs to HDR format to use as high-quality lighting probes or environment maps in 3D software, creating more realistic and physically accurate lighting and reflections in their scenes.

Convert product photography TIFFs to HDR for e-commerce visuals

E-commerce businesses and photographers convert product shots from TIFF to HDR to showcase items with superior detail in both shadows and highlights. This results in more vibrant, true-to-life online images that can enhance customer perception and potentially reduce return rates.

Process aerial survey TIFFs to HDR for enhanced geospatial analysis

Geospatial analysts and surveyors convert aerial or satellite imagery from TIFF to HDR to retain a greater range of luminance values. This improves the clarity of features in both very bright and deeply shadowed areas, aiding in more accurate land-use analysis and mapping.

Upgrade historical photo TIFF archives to HDR for preservation

Museums and libraries convert scanned historical photographs from TIFF to HDR to preserve a broader spectrum of tonal details recovered during the scanning process. This future-proofs digital archives, capturing nuances that might be crucial for future research or restoration efforts.

Convert CGI and VFX TIFF renders to HDR for post-production

Visual effects artists working on films or games convert their final TIFF render passes—such as beauty passes, lighting passes, or specular highlights—to HDR. This allows for greater flexibility and non-destructive color grading and compositing in post-production pipelines without losing highlight or shadow detail.

Prepare TIFF texture maps for HDR-based game engines

Game developers convert texture maps (like albedo, roughness, or metalness maps) from TIFF to HDR to be used in modern, physically-based rendering (PBR) game engines. HDR textures ensure that lighting and material interactions are calculated more accurately, leading to higher visual fidelity in the final game.

Transform scientific data visualization TIFFs to HDR for publication

Researchers and scientists convert false-color TIFF images representing complex data (e.g., from telescopes, microscopes, or simulations) to HDR format. This ensures that the full range of data values is visually represented in publications or presentations, preventing the loss of critical information at the extremes of the data set.

Convert real estate photography TIFFs to HDR for virtual tours

Real estate photographers convert bracketed exposure TIFFs of property interiors into a single HDR file. This creates a final image that accurately represents both the bright view through a window and the details in the darker corners of a room, providing a more realistic and appealing online viewing experience.
